Abstract

This Internet-Draft describes Load Selection (LOADSEL) for Signalling User Adaptation Protocols [IUA], [DUA], [V5UA], [M2UA], [M3UA], [SUA], [GR303UA], [ISUA], [TUA], which permits an Application Server Processes (ASP) to indicate its placement within an Application Server and permits an Signalling Gateway (SG) to distribute traffic over ASPs in Application Servers under Application Server Process (ASP) control.
